18.03 An amendment may be proposed by either the Board of Directors or by the Members,and after being proposed and approved by one ofsuch bodies,it must be approved by the other as above set forth in order to become enacted as an amendment. 18.04 Amendments to these By-laws shall be made in accordance with the requirements ofthe law and amendments thereto in effect at the time ofamendment. 18.05 No modification or amendment to these By-Laws shall be effective which would affect or impair the priority or validity of a mortgage held by any Institutional Mortgagee or Declarant, without the Institutional Mortgagee's or Declarant's prior written consent.
ARTICLE XIX
19.01 In the event ofany conflict between the provisions ofthe Declaration,the Articles and the provisions ofthese By-Laws,the provisions ofthe Declaration and/or Articles shall prevail.
